1. Saving Private Ryan (1998) - Directed by Steven Spielberg, this movie follows a group of soldiers during World War II as they search for a paratrooper whose brothers have been killed in action. It's known for its intense and realistic depiction of warfare.

2. Dunkirk (2017) - A war film by Christopher Nolan, Dunkirk captures the evacuation of British and Allied troops from the beaches of Dunkirk during World War II. It's a gripping and suspenseful movie that offers a unique perspective on the war.

3. häçksaw Ridge (2016) - Based on a true story, this film tells the extraordinary tale of Desmond Doss, a conscientious objector who served as a medic during World War II without carrying a weapon. It's a powerful and inspiring story of courage and faith.

4. The Thin Red Line (1998) - Directed by Terrence Malick, this movie explores the experiences of soldiers in the Battle of Guadalcanal during World War II. It's a visually stunning film that delves into the psychological impact of war.

5. 1917 (2019) - Set during World War I, this film follows two British soldiers tasked with delivering a message to save a battalion from walking into a trap. It's known for its immersive cinematography and the sense of urgency it creates.

6. Platoon (1986) - Directed by Oliver Stone, Platoon offers a gritty and realistic portrayal of the Vietnam War. It tells the story of a young soldier's experience in the conflict and explores themes of morality and the psychological toll of war.

1. Full Metal Jacket (1987) - Directed by Stanley Kubrick, this film provides a raw and gritty look at the Vietnam War. It follows a group of U.S. Marine recruits through their training and deployment to Vietnam.

2. Black Hawk Down (2001) - Based on a true story, this movie depicts the U.S. military's attempt to capture Somali warlords in 1993. It's an intense and action-packed film that explores the challenges and sacrifices of modern warfare.

3. The Hurt Locker (2008) - Directed by Kathryn Bigelow, this Academy Award-winning film focuses on an Explosive Ordnance Disposal (EOD) team during the Iraq War. It provides a gripping portrayal of the dangers and psychological toll of bomb disposal.

4. Letters from Iwo Jima (2006) - Directed by Clint Eastwood, this film offers a unique perspective by portraying the Battle of Iwo Jima from the Japanese soldiers' point of view. It's a thought-provoking exploration of the human cost of war.

5. Enemy at the Gates (2001) - Set during the Battle of Stalingrad in World War II, this film follows a Soviet sniper who becomes a legend as he faces off against a skilled German sniper. It's a tense and thrilling war drama.
